Android中的条形码扫描器

时间:2012-08-02 08:23:23

标签: android

我想创建一个可以读取Ba代码的应用程序。我希望通过我的应用程序不使用像'ZXing'这样的第三方应用程序来实现这一点。请任何编码帮助或tatorial ...

3 个答案:

答案 0 :(得分:1)

我已经通过使用我的应用程序直接扫描条形码来完成Android应用程序。我使用Zxing条形码来获取我想要的功能,并且很容易制作自己的扫描条形码的应用程序。

更具体地说,您需要做的是设计一个可以拍照的屏幕,然后您只需要使用Camera对象,当您捕获图像时,将其以Bitmap格式放在一个ZXing方法的参数中。然后你将获得结果,你可以按照你想要的那样显示它。

如果您对此有更具体的问题,请随时提出。我可以检索我的代码来帮助你。

答案 1 :(得分:0)

如果你去这里:http://code.google.com/p/zxing/wiki/ScanningViaIntent 并按照说明进行操作,以添加网站中描述的类和代码。

一旦你实施了它,扫描仪就添加了..

答案 2 :(得分:0)

我建议您查看适用于Android的免费Scandit barcode scanner SDK。它附带了分步指南,示例代码和教学视频如何开始,它也适用于没有自动对焦摄像头和/或有限分辨率的低端Android设备。

如果您有兴趣将扫描的UPC编号转换为产品名称,还有product API

[免责声明:我是Scandit的开发人员]